     Tanya Tucker is Kicking off the CMT Next Women of Country Tour tonight with special guest Brandi Carlisle.  Carlisle is the first in a lineup or rotating guests including  Aubrie Sellers, Brandy Clark, Erin Enderlin, Hailey Whitters, Madison Kozak, Walker County, and shooter Shooter Jennings.  The tour rolls into Albany May 22nd.

 Miranda Lambert fans are hoping that she is on the mend after illness forced her to cancel two shows over the weekend in Denver and Salt Lake City. She has promised make good shows in both cities within a month.    Miranda is set to add to an already frenzied week in Kansas City Tomorrow night.  Fans in the Show Me State are waiting with fingers crossed.

    Billy Ray Cyrus says talks are in motion for a Hannah Montana prequel. The landmark kids tv show relaunched Billy Ray’s career and made Miley Cyrus a household name in the mid 2000s.  Billy Ray says the best part of revisiting Hannah Montana would be getting his mullet back.
